Choosing the Right Skip Size
Size Guide
We offer all sizes of skips for hire in South Ruislip, Southampton, and other cities and towns. Find the ideal skip size for your project, event, or business premises with our size guide:
- 4 Yard: (H x W x L ft) 3 × 5 × 8. Designed for mixed or heavy waste from small clear-outs, limited landscaping, and other smaller projects.
- 6 Yard: (H x W x L ft) 4 × 5.5 × 9. A good size for heavy waste generated by home renovations and other small projects.
- 8 Yard: (H x W x L ft) 4.5 × 5.5 × 11. Ideal for bulky and heavy waste from home clear-outs and refurbishments, smaller commercial operations, and other small to medium projects.
- 12 Yard: (H x W x L ft) 5.5 × 5.5 × 13. Designed for bulkier waste types generated by smaller construction projects, office refurbishments and events.
- 16 Yard: (H x W x L ft) 6.5 × 5.5 × 14. A good choice for bulky waste generated by construction projects and small to medium industrial operations.
- 20 Yard: (H x W x L ft), 4.3 × 7.9 × 20. Ideal for high waste volumes generated by large industrial operations and events.
40 Yard: (H x W x L ft) 8.2 × 7.9 × 20. Perfect for higher volumes of waste generated by large events, commercial operations, and construction projects.

Do I need a permit to place a skip on a public road in Southampton?
Yes, you require a Southampton skip hire permit to place a skip on the highway, whether it be a public road, pavement, or pathway. We will apply for a permit on your behalf. The Southampton City Council encourages the placement of skips on private land, where permits aren’t required.
How long can I hire a skip for?
You can hire a skip in Southampton for as long as you need. However, you can only keep a skip on a road, pathway, or verge if you have a valid permit, which will be valid for up to 28 days. We will apply for a permit renewal if you require the skip for longer.
What can and cannot be placed in skips in Southampton?
You can place non-hazardous materials in skips in Southampton, such as concrete, bricks, and rubble, flooring and carpet, clothing and textiles, magazines and books, paper and cardboard, garden refuse, and general household waste.
You cannot place harmful or hazardous materials in skips, such as asbestos, plasterboard, fluorescent tubes and lightbulbs, empty gas cylinders and aerosols, fuel and chemicals, oil, paint tins (unless empty), paint and solvents, fridges and freezers, televisions, batteries, and medical waste.
Road Sizes and Permits for Skip Hire in Southampton
Understanding Road Sizes
Residential streets: The numerous narrow residential streets in Southampton, especially in older residential areas, might impact your intended skip location as well as how you access it. Think carefully when choosing the size, paying special attention to the amount of street space available, before you hire a skip in Southampton.
Commercial areas: If you’re going to place a skip in one of the city’s commercial or industrial areas, make sure that your chosen location is in line with any of the city council’s additional regulations or restrictions for business premises.
Major roads: You may need to collaborate with local authorities for traffic management, do additional planning, or take additional safety measures if you plan to place a skip on a major road or in another area with heavy traffic.
Permit Requirements
When permits are needed: You require a Southampton skip hire permit if you intend to place a skip on a public road, pavement, pathway, or verge. The council will approve the application if the skip placement does not obstruct traffic or pedestrians.
How to obtain a permit: According to city council regulations, only licensed skip providers may apply for permits. Our friendly staff will apply for a permit on your behalf, making sure it satisfies the necessary requirements.
Permit costs: The city council’s fee for a standard Southampton skip hire license is £36 per week. The license can be renewed for a further £36 per week. We will provide guidance on these and any other costs involved in your permit application.
Permit duration: The Southampton City Council issues skip permits valid for one week at a time. However, thanks to permit renewals, you can place the skip on a public road for up to 28 days.
Additional Tips
Check local regulations: The city council might have extra requirements or relevant regulations specific to your area. Check for these with the council before booking skip hire in Southampton.
Consider safety: Make sure that the skip placement does not put the safety of drivers or pedestrians at risk. If necessary, set up safety measures such as signage, barriers, and lighting and/or reflectors.
Coordinate with neighbours: Inform neighbours if you intend to place the skip near residential properties to minimise or avoid inconvenience.
